• Title of article

    Voltammetric determination of riboflavin based on electrocatalytic oxidation at zeolite-modified carbon paste electrodes

  • Abstract
    Carbon-paste electrode modified with Co2+-Y zeolite was used in voltammetric determination of riboflavin. Maximum anodic voltammetric current, due to the redox behavior of Co2+ ions, was observed in 0.1 mol L−1 KNO3 with pH 5. The modified electrode showed a catalytic behavior in electro-oxidation of riboflavin, lowering the over-potential of the reaction by ∼200 mV. The effect of several parameters such as pH and concentration of the supporting electrolyte was investigated. The cyclic voltammetric response of the electrode to riboflavin was linear in the range of 1.7 to 34 μmol L−1 with a detection limit of 0.71 μmol L−1.
